Global Commercial Refrigeration Market Trends

Current Valuation and 2030 Projections

The global commercial refrigeration market was valued at approximately $39.88 billion in 2023 and is projected to reach $65 billion by 2032, reflecting a compound annual growth rate (CAGR) of 5.58% over the forecast period (SNS Insider). This growth is driven by a rising demand for refrigerated goods, particularly in food services and pharmaceutical sectors, as consumers increasingly prefer frozen and chilled products. Market segmentation highlights the significance of various refrigeration types—refrigerators and freezers lead with a 24.08% share in 2023, driven by sectors such as health care and food service (SNS Insider). These trends underscore the evolving landscape and future valuation impact within the commercial refrigeration sector.

Regional Growth in North America and Asia-Pacific

North America remains a pivotal market in commercial refrigeration due to its established retail channels and commitment to food safety standards. The region accounted for a 34.8% market share in 2023, bolstered by major grocery chains like Walmart and Costco (SNS Insider). Conversely, the Asia-Pacific region is experiencing rapid expansion, projected to grow at a CAGR of over 6.4% from 2024 to 2032 (SNS Insider). This growth is fueled by increasing urbanization, disposable income, and the expansion of commercial activities. Energy Efficiency & Sustainable Solutions

ENERGY STAR-Certified Systems and Energy Savings

Implementing ENERGY STAR-certified refrigeration systems offers substantial benefits, including up to 30% energy savings compared to non-certified models. These savings not only reduce operating costs but also support environmental sustainability objectives, making them an attractive option for businesses. Recent studies underscore a growing preference for ENERGY STAR systems among enterprises aiming to enhance their energy efficiency and lower their carbon footprint. Additionally, various government incentives are available to encourage businesses to adopt these energy-efficient solutions, further amplifying their cost-effectiveness and appeal.

Transition to Low-GWP Refrigerants like CO2

The refrigeration industry is increasingly transitioning to low-global warming potential (GWP) refrigerants, such as carbon dioxide (CO2), to mitigate environmental impact. This shift is driven by both regulatory pressures and advancements in refrigeration technology. These low-GWP refrigerants significantly reduce the industry’s carbon footprint, aligning with global sustainability goals. Regulatory Impacts on Industry Practices

F-Gas Regulations and Kigali Amendment Compliance

F-gas regulations significantly impact the refrigeration industry’s practices by enforcing stricter limits on high-GWP (Global Warming Potential) refrigerants. These regulations are designed to minimize the release of harmful gases that contribute to climate change. Compliance with the Kigali Amendment is essential for manufacturers and users who are committed to reducing greenhouse gas emissions. The amendment aims to phase down the production and use of potent greenhouse gases like hydrofluorocarbons (HFCs). Statistics indicate that adherence to these regulations not only supports environmental sustainability but also drives companies towards innovative, eco-friendly solutions.

Cold Chain Demands in Food Retail

The cold chain is a crucial component in the food retail sector, ensuring that products are preserved at optimal quality from supplier to consumer. Effective refrigeration prevents the spoilage of perishable goods and maintains their nutritional value. Statistics indicate that approximately 48 million Americans experience foodborne illnesses annually, many of which are attributed to inadequate refrigeration, emphasizing the importance of reliable solutions (Centers for Disease Control and Prevention). By maintaining stringent temperature controls, food retailers can uphold public health standards, reduce waste, and safeguard consumer trust.

Pharmacy Storage Needs (e.g., CVS Medication Preservation)

Pharmaceuticals require precise refrigeration to maintain their effectiveness and safety, with pharmacies like CVS implementing stringent standards to preserve medications. Proper temperature control is vital to prevent drug degradation, ensuring vaccines and medications remain potent and safe. Any failure in temperature regulation can result in compromised patient safety and substantial financial loss, necessitating robust refrigeration systems.
